Apanteles diniamartinezae

General description: 

Type locality. COSTA RICA, Guanacaste, ACG, Sector Cacao, Estación Cacao,
1150m, 10.92691, -85.46822.
Holotype. ♀ in CNC. Specimen labels: 1. DHJPAR0002688. 2. COSTA
RICA: Guanacaste, Area de Consveración Guanacaste: Sector Cacao: Estación Cacao,
10/15/2002, Mariano Pereira. 3. 02-SRNP-24195, Astraptes augeas, feeding on Hampea
appendiculata.
Paratypes. 39 ♀, 40 ♂ (BMNH, CNC, INBIO, INHS, NMNH). COSTA
RICA, ACG database codes: See Appendix 2 for detailed label data.
Description. Female. Metatibia color (outer face): entirely or mostly (>0.7 metatibia
length) dark brown to black, with yellow to white coloration usually restricted to
anterior 0.2 or less. Fore wing veins color: veins C+Sc+R and R1 with brown coloration
restricted narrowly to borders, interior area of those veins and pterostigma (and sometimes
veins r, 2RS and 2M) transparent or white; other veins mostly transparent. Antenna
length/body length: antenna shorter than body (head to apex of metasoma), not
extending beyond anterior 0.7 metasoma length. Body length (head to apex of metasoma):
2.1–2.2 mm or 2.3–2.4 mm. Fore wing length: 2.3–2.4 mm or 2.5–2.6 mm.
Metafemur length/width: 2.8–2.9, 3.0–3.1, rarely 3.2–3.3. Mediotergite 1 length/
width at posterior margin: 2.1–2.2, 2.3–2.4, rarely 2.9 or more. Mediotergite 1 maximum
width/width at posterior margin: 1.4–1.5 or 1.6–1.7. Ovipositor sheaths length/
metafemur length: 0.8 or 0.9. Ovipositor sheaths length/metatibia length: 0.7 or 0.8.
Molecular data. Sequences in BOLD: 75, barcode compliant sequences: 63.
Biology/ecology. Gregarious (Fig. 309). Hosts: Hesperiidae, Astraptes augeas, Astraptes
obstupefactus, Astraptes syncedoche, Astraptes inflatio, Astraptes fruticibus. Distribution. Costa Rica, ACG.
